Show patches with: Submitter = Sergei Shtylyov       |   337 patches
« 1 2 3 4 »
Patch Series A/F/R/T S/W/F Date Submitter Delegate State
MAINTAINERS: switch to my private email for Renesas Ethernet drivers MAINTAINERS: switch to my private email for Renesas Ethernet drivers 1 - - - --- 2020-06-13 Sergei Shtylyov davem Accepted
[net-next,v2,5/5] sh_eth: use Gigabit register map for R7S72100 sh_eth: get rid of the dedicated regiseter mapping for RZ/A1 (R7S72100) - - - 1 --- 2020-02-15 Sergei Shtylyov davem Accepted
[net-next,v2,4/5] sh_eth: add sh_eth_cpu_data::gecmr flag sh_eth: get rid of the dedicated regiseter mapping for RZ/A1 (R7S72100) - - - 1 --- 2020-02-15 Sergei Shtylyov davem Accepted
[net-next,v2,3/5] sh_eth: check sh_eth_cpu_data::no_xdfar when dumping registers sh_eth: get rid of the dedicated regiseter mapping for RZ/A1 (R7S72100) - 1 - 1 --- 2020-02-15 Sergei Shtylyov davem Accepted
[net-next,v2,2/5] sh_eth: check sh_eth_cpu_data::cexcr when dumping registers sh_eth: get rid of the dedicated regiseter mapping for RZ/A1 (R7S72100) - 1 - 1 --- 2020-02-15 Sergei Shtylyov davem Accepted
[net-next,v2,1/5] sh_eth: check sh_eth_cpu_data::no_tx_cntrs when dumping registers sh_eth: get rid of the dedicated regiseter mapping for RZ/A1 (R7S72100) - 1 - 1 --- 2020-02-15 Sergei Shtylyov davem Accepted
[net] sh_eth: check sh_eth_cpu_data::dual_port when dumping registers [net] sh_eth: check sh_eth_cpu_data::dual_port when dumping registers - 1 - - --- 2020-01-08 Sergei Shtylyov davem Accepted
[v2,7/7] sh_eth: offload RX checksum on SH7763 sh_eth: implement simple RX checksum offload - - - - --- 2019-02-04 Sergei Shtylyov davem Accepted
[v2,6/7] sh_eth: offload RX checksum on SH7734 sh_eth: implement simple RX checksum offload - - - - --- 2019-02-04 Sergei Shtylyov davem Accepted
[v2,5/7] sh_eth: offload RX checksum on R8A77980 sh_eth: implement simple RX checksum offload - - - - --- 2019-02-04 Sergei Shtylyov davem Accepted
[v2,4/7] sh_eth: offload RX checksum on R8A7740 sh_eth: implement simple RX checksum offload - - - 1 --- 2019-02-04 Sergei Shtylyov davem Accepted
[v2,3/7] sh_eth: offload RX checksum on R7S72100 sh_eth: implement simple RX checksum offload - - - - --- 2019-02-04 Sergei Shtylyov davem Accepted
[v2,2/7] sh_eth: RX checksum offload support sh_eth: implement simple RX checksum offload - - - - --- 2019-02-04 Sergei Shtylyov davem Accepted
[v2,1/7] sh_eth: rename sh_eth_cpu_data::hw_checksum sh_eth: implement simple RX checksum offload - - 1 - --- 2019-02-04 Sergei Shtylyov davem Accepted
[7/7] sh_eth: offload RX checksum on SH7763 sh_eth: implement simple RX checksum offload - - - - --- 2019-01-27 Sergei Shtylyov davem Changes Requested
[6/7] sh_eth: offload RX checksum on SH7734 sh_eth: implement simple RX checksum offload - - - - --- 2019-01-27 Sergei Shtylyov davem Changes Requested
[5/7] sh_eth: offload RX checksum on R8A77980 sh_eth: implement simple RX checksum offload - - - - --- 2019-01-27 Sergei Shtylyov davem Changes Requested
[4/7] sh_eth: offload RX checksum on R8A7740 sh_eth: implement simple RX checksum offload - - - 1 --- 2019-01-27 Sergei Shtylyov davem Changes Requested
[3/7] sh_eth: offload RX checksum on R7S72100 sh_eth: implement simple RX checksum offload - - - - --- 2019-01-27 Sergei Shtylyov davem Changes Requested
[2/7] sh_eth: RX checksum offload support sh_eth: implement simple RX checksum offload - - - - --- 2019-01-27 Sergei Shtylyov davem Changes Requested
[1/7] sh_eth: rename sh_eth_cpu_data::hw_checksum sh_eth: implement simple RX checksum offload - - 1 - --- 2019-01-27 Sergei Shtylyov davem Changes Requested
[5/5] sh_eth: make sh_eth_tsu_{read|write}_entry() prototypes symmetric sh_eth: clean up the TSU register accessors - - 1 - --- 2018-07-23 Sergei Shtylyov davem Accepted
[4/5] sh_eth: make sh_eth_tsu_write_entry() take 'offset' parameter sh_eth: clean up the TSU register accessors - - 1 - --- 2018-07-23 Sergei Shtylyov davem Accepted
[3/5] sh_eth: call sh_eth_tsu_get_offset() from TSU register accessors sh_eth: clean up the TSU register accessors - - 1 - --- 2018-07-23 Sergei Shtylyov davem Accepted
[2/5] sh_eth: make sh_eth_tsu_get_offset() match its name sh_eth: clean up the TSU register accessors - - 1 - --- 2018-07-23 Sergei Shtylyov davem Accepted
[1/5] sh_eth: uninline sh_eth_tsu_get_offset() sh_eth: clean up the TSU register accessors - - 1 - --- 2018-07-23 Sergei Shtylyov davem Accepted
[net-next] sh_eth: fix *enum* {A|M}PR_BIT [net-next] sh_eth: fix *enum* {A|M}PR_BIT - - 1 - --- 2018-06-26 Sergei Shtylyov davem Accepted
[2/2] sh_eth: remove sh_eth_cpu_data::rpadir_value sh_eth: RPADIR related clean-ups - - 1 - --- 2018-06-25 Sergei Shtylyov davem Accepted
[1/2] sh_eth: fix *enum* RPADIR_BIT sh_eth: RPADIR related clean-ups - - 1 - --- 2018-06-25 Sergei Shtylyov davem Accepted
[3/3] sh_eth: use DIV_ROUND_UP() in sh_eth_soft_swap() sh_eth: fix & clean up sh_eth_soft_swap() - - 1 - --- 2018-06-02 Sergei Shtylyov davem Accepted
[2/3] sh_eth: uninline sh_eth_soft_swap() sh_eth: fix & clean up sh_eth_soft_swap() - - 1 - --- 2018-06-02 Sergei Shtylyov davem Accepted
[1/3] sh_eth: make sh_eth_soft_swap() work on ARM sh_eth: fix & clean up sh_eth_soft_swap() - - 1 - --- 2018-06-02 Sergei Shtylyov davem Accepted
[3/3] sh_eth: fix typo in comment to BCULR write sh_eth: fix typos/grammar - - - - --- 2018-05-19 Sergei Shtylyov davem Accepted
[2/3] sh_eth: fix comment grammar in 'struct sh_eth_cpu_data' sh_eth: fix typos/grammar - - - - --- 2018-05-19 Sergei Shtylyov davem Accepted
[1/3] sh_eth: fix typo in EESR.TRO bit name sh_eth: fix typos/grammar - - - - --- 2018-05-19 Sergei Shtylyov davem Accepted
[v2,3/3] sh_eth: add R8A77980 support Add Renesas R8A77980 GEther support - - 1 - --- 2018-05-18 Sergei Shtylyov davem Accepted
[v2,2/3] sh_eth: add EDMR.NBST support Add Renesas R8A77980 GEther support - - 1 - --- 2018-05-18 Sergei Shtylyov davem Accepted
[v2,1/1] sh_eth: add RGMII support Add Renesas R8A77980 GEther support - - 1 - --- 2018-05-18 Sergei Shtylyov davem Accepted
[3/3] sh_eth: add R8A77980 support Add R8A77980 GEther support - - 1 - --- 2018-05-16 Sergei Shtylyov davem Changes Requested
[2/3] sh_eth: add EDMR.NBST support Add R8A77980 GEther support - - 1 - --- 2018-05-16 Sergei Shtylyov davem Changes Requested
[1/3] sh_eth: add RGMII support Add R8A77980 GEther support - - - - --- 2018-05-16 Sergei Shtylyov davem Changes Requested
[2/2] sh_eth: WARN_ON() access to unimplemented TSU register sh_eth: complain on access to unimplemented TSU registers - - - - --- 2018-05-02 Sergei Shtylyov davem Accepted
[1/2] sh_eth: use TSU register accessors for TSU_POST<n> sh_eth: complain on access to unimplemented TSU registers - - - - --- 2018-05-02 Sergei Shtylyov davem Accepted
DT: net: can: rcar_canfd: document R8A77980 bindings DT: net: can: rcar_canfd: document R8A77980 bindings - - 1 - --- 2018-04-27 Sergei Shtylyov davem Awaiting Upstream
DT: net: can: rcar_canfd: document R8A77970 bindings DT: net: can: rcar_canfd: document R8A77970 bindings - - 2 - --- 2018-04-26 Sergei Shtylyov davem Not Applicable
[net-next,2/2] sh_eth: kill useless check in __sh_eth_get_regs() sh_eth: remove SH_ETH_OFFSET_INVALID abuses - - - - --- 2018-03-31 Sergei Shtylyov davem Accepted
[net-next,1/2] sh_eth: add sh_eth_cpu_data::no_xdfar flag sh_eth: remove SH_ETH_OFFSET_INVALID abuses - - - - --- 2018-03-31 Sergei Shtylyov davem Accepted
[5/5] sh_eth: add sh_eth_cpu_data::cexcr flag sh_eth: unify the SoC feature checks - - - - --- 2018-03-24 Sergei Shtylyov davem Accepted
[4/5] sh_eth: add sh_eth_cpu_data::no_tx_cntr flag sh_eth: unify the SoC feature checks - - - - --- 2018-03-24 Sergei Shtylyov davem Accepted
[3/5] sh_eth: add sh_eth_cpu_data::xdfar_rw flag sh_eth: unify the SoC feature checks - - - - --- 2018-03-24 Sergei Shtylyov davem Accepted
[2/5] sh_eth: add sh_eth_cpu_data::edtrr_trns value sh_eth: unify the SoC feature checks - - - - --- 2018-03-24 Sergei Shtylyov davem Accepted
[1/5] sh_eth: add sh_eth_cpu_data::soft_reset() method sh_eth: unify the SoC feature checks - - - - --- 2018-03-24 Sergei Shtylyov davem Accepted
[net-next] sh_eth: uninline TSU register accessors [net-next] sh_eth: uninline TSU register accessors - - - - --- 2018-02-27 Sergei Shtylyov davem Accepted
[net-next] sh_eth: fix TSU init on SH7734/R8A7740 [net-next] sh_eth: fix TSU init on SH7734/R8A7740 - 2 - 1 --- 2018-02-24 Sergei Shtylyov davem Accepted
[net-next] sh_eth: TSU_QTAG0/1 registers the same as TSU_QTAGM0/1 [net-next] sh_eth: TSU_QTAG0/1 registers the same as TSU_QTAGM0/1 - 1 - - --- 2018-02-24 Sergei Shtylyov davem Accepted
sh_eth: simplify sh_eth_check_reset() sh_eth: simplify sh_eth_check_reset() - - 1 - --- 2018-02-18 Sergei Shtylyov davem Accepted
DT: net: renesas,ravb: document R8A77980 bindings DT: net: renesas,ravb: document R8A77980 bindings - - 3 - --- 2018-02-01 Sergei Shtylyov davem Accepted
[2/2] sh_eth: get Ether port # only when needed sh_eth: simplify TSU initialization - - 1 - --- 2018-01-14 Sergei Shtylyov davem Accepted
[1/2] sh_eth: gather all TSU init code in one place sh_eth: simplify TSU initialization - - 1 - --- 2018-01-14 Sergei Shtylyov davem Accepted
sh_eth: dix dumping ARSTR sh_eth: dix dumping ARSTR - 1 - - --- 2018-01-13 Sergei Shtylyov davem Accepted
sh_eth: fix TXALCR1 offsets sh_eth: fix TXALCR1 offsets - 1 - - --- 2018-01-06 Sergei Shtylyov davem Accepted
[2/2] SolutionEngine771x: add Ether TSU resource Ether fixes for the SolutionEngine771x boards - 1 - - --- 2018-01-06 Sergei Shtylyov davem Accepted
[1/2] SolutionEngine771x: fix Ether platform data Ether fixes for the SolutionEngine771x boards - 1 - - --- 2018-01-06 Sergei Shtylyov davem Accepted
sh_eth: remove sh_eth_plat_data::edmac_endian sh_eth: remove sh_eth_plat_data::edmac_endian - - - - --- 2018-01-04 Sergei Shtylyov davem Accepted
sh_eth: fix SH7757 GEther initialization sh_eth: fix SH7757 GEther initialization - 1 - - --- 2018-01-04 Sergei Shtylyov davem Accepted
[2/2] SolutionEngine771x: add Ether TSU resource Ether fixes for the SolutionEngine771x boards - 1 - - --- 2018-01-03 Sergei Shtylyov davem Not Applicable
[1/2] SolutionEngine771x: fix Ether platform data Ether fixes for the SolutionEngine771x boards - 1 - - --- 2018-01-03 Sergei Shtylyov davem Not Applicable
sh_eth: fix TSU resource handling sh_eth: fix TSU resource handling - 1 - - --- 2018-01-03 Sergei Shtylyov davem Accepted
[2/2] sh_eth: kill redundant check in the probe() method Untitled series #20775 - - 1 - --- 2017-12-31 Sergei Shtylyov davem Accepted
[1/2] ravb: kill redundant check in the probe() method [1/2] ravb: kill redundant check in the probe() method - - 1 - --- 2017-12-31 Sergei Shtylyov davem Accepted
MAINTAINERS: review Renesas DT bindings as well MAINTAINERS: review Renesas DT bindings as well - - - - --- 2017-09-13 Sergei Shtylyov davem Accepted
ravb: document R8A77970 bindings ravb: document R8A77970 bindings 1 - 1 - --- 2017-09-12 Sergei Shtylyov davem Accepted
of_mdio: merge branch tails in of_phy_register_fixed_link() - - - - --- 2017-08-12 Sergei Shtylyov davem Accepted
of_mdio: use of_property_read_u32_array() - - 2 - --- 2017-08-04 Sergei Shtylyov davem Accepted
mv643xx_eth: fix of_irq_to_resource() error check - - - - --- 2017-07-29 Sergei Shtylyov davem Accepted
of_mdio: kill useless variable in of_phy_register_fixed_link() - - - - --- 2017-07-23 Sergei Shtylyov davem Accepted
[2/2] mdio_bus: use devm_gpiod_get_optional() - - - - --- 2017-06-12 Sergei Shtylyov davem Accepted
[1/2] mdio_bus: handle only single PHY reset GPIO - - - - --- 2017-06-12 Sergei Shtylyov davem Accepted
[v2] sh_eth: unmap DMA buffers when freeing rings - - - - --- 2017-04-17 Sergei Shtylyov davem Accepted
sh_eth: unmap DMA buffers when freeing rings - - - - --- 2017-04-16 Sergei Shtylyov davem Superseded
[v2,3/3] sh_eth: stop using bare numbers for EESIPR values - - 1 - --- 2017-01-29 Sergei Shtylyov davem Accepted
[v2,2/3] sh_eth: add missing EESIPR bits - - 1 - --- 2017-01-29 Sergei Shtylyov davem Accepted
[v2,1/3] sh_eth: rename EESIPR bits - - - - --- 2017-01-29 Sergei Shtylyov davem Accepted
[3/3] sh_eth: stop using bare numbers for EESIPR values - - 1 - --- 2017-01-22 Sergei Shtylyov davem Changes Requested
[2/3] sh_eth: add missing EESIPR bits - - 1 - --- 2017-01-22 Sergei Shtylyov davem Changes Requested
[1/3] sh_eth: rename EESIPR bits - - - - --- 2017-01-22 Sergei Shtylyov davem Changes Requested
[2/2] sh_eth: rename 'sh_eth_cpu_data::hw_crc' - - - - --- 2017-01-06 Sergei Shtylyov davem Accepted
[1/2] sh_eth: get rid of 'sh_eth_cpu_data::shift_rd0' - - - - --- 2017-01-06 Sergei Shtylyov davem Accepted
sh_eth: R8A7740 supports packet shecksumming - - - - --- 2017-01-04 Sergei Shtylyov davem Accepted
sh_eth: enable RX descriptor word 0 shift on SH7734 - - - - --- 2017-01-04 Sergei Shtylyov davem Accepted
sh_eth: fix EESIPR values for SH77{34|63} - - - - --- 2017-01-04 Sergei Shtylyov davem Accepted
[3/3] sh_eth: factor out sh_eth_emac_interrupt() - - - - --- 2017-01-04 Sergei Shtylyov davem Accepted
[2/3] sh_eth: no need for *else* after *goto* - - - - --- 2017-01-04 Sergei Shtylyov davem Accepted
[1/3] sh_eth: handle only enabled E-MAC interrupts - - - - --- 2017-01-04 Sergei Shtylyov davem Accepted
sh_eth: fix branch prediction in sh_eth_interrupt() - - - - --- 2016-12-29 Sergei Shtylyov davem Accepted
[resend] sh_eth: add R8A7743/5 support 1 - - - --- 2016-09-26 Sergei Shtylyov davem Accepted
sh_eth: add R8A7743/5 support - - - - --- 2016-09-26 Sergei Shtylyov davem Superseded
[2/2] sh_eth: fix DMA channel misreporting - - - - --- 2016-07-17 Sergei Shtylyov davem Accepted
[1/2] ravb: fix DMA channel misreporting - - - - --- 2016-07-17 Sergei Shtylyov davem Accepted
[2/2] lxt: simplify lxt970_config_init() - - - - --- 2016-05-13 Sergei Shtylyov davem Accepted
« 1 2 3 4 »